Most Americans have their tissue on file somewhere. In 1999 the RAND Corporation published a report that more than 307 million tissue samples from more than 178 million people were stored in the United States. This number, the report said, was increasing by more than 20 million samples each year. These samples come from routine medical tests, operations, clinical trials and research donations. Sampling Techniques
There are two overarching types of sampling, probability and nonprobability sampling. The most commonly used sampling techniques, which were discussed in your text, include random sampling, stratified random sampling and cluster sampling. These three sampling techniques are grouped under probability sampling because all members of the identified population have an equal chance of being selected for the sample. Convenience and quota sampling fall under the nonprobability sampling type because all members of the identified population do not have an equal chance of being selected for participation in the sample.
